    Erectile dysfunction (ED) is a common condition that affects millions of men worldwide. Defined by the inability to achieve or maintain an erection sufficient for sexual activity, ED has psychological, physical, and emotional implications for men and their partners. Over the years, research in this field has led to significant advancements in treatment options, diagnosis, and understanding of ED. Several key authorities and institutions have been at the forefront of this progress, contributing to the improved management and care of erectile dysfunction. This article explores three of the most prominent authorities in the field of ED.

    2. The Sexual Medicine Society of North America (SMSNA)

    The Sexual Medicine Society of North America (SMSNA) is another leading authority in the field of erectile dysfunction. The SMSNA is a multidisciplinary organization that focuses on promoting research and education related to sexual health and dysfunction, including ED. Formed in 1994, the society brings together physicians, researchers, and healthcare professionals who are dedicated to improving the understanding and treatment of sexual health conditions.

    Key Contributions to ED:

    • Promoting Sexual Health Research: The SMSNA has been instrumental in advancing research in sexual medicine. It provides grants, awards, and support for innovative research projects that focus on improving the understanding of ED, its causes, and treatment options. The society encourages collaboration between specialists, including urologists, endocrinologists, psychologists, and cardiologists, to better understand the complex nature of erectile dysfunction.
    • Educational Programs and Conferences: The SMSNA hosts annual conferences that bring together experts in sexual medicine to discuss the latest advancements in the field. These conferences are a platform for presenting cutting-edge research, new treatment modalities, and updates on clinical best practices. Through these gatherings, the SMSNA fosters a multidisciplinary approach to treating ED, recognizing that the condition often has multiple contributing factors, from cardiovascular health to psychological wellbeing.

    3. The International Society for Sexual Medicine (ISSM)

    The International Society for Sexual Medicine (ISSM) is a global authority on sexual health, including erectile dysfunction. Established in 1978, the ISSM aims to promote research, education, and clinical practice in the field of sexual medicine. It is an international organization, bringing together experts from around the world to share knowledge and advancements in understanding sexual dysfunction.

    Global Impact on ED Research and Treatment:

    • International Guidelines: One of the ISSM’s most significant contributions to the field of erectile dysfunction is the development of international guidelines for the diagnosis and treatment of ED. These guidelines help standardize care worldwide, ensuring that patients receive consistent and high-quality treatment regardless of where they live. The ISSM guidelines are based on the latest scientific research and are regularly updated to reflect new findings and advancements in the field.
    • Fostering Collaboration and Research: The ISSM is known for its emphasis on global collaboration in research. By bringing together experts from different regions, the society fosters an environment where diverse perspectives and approaches to sexual medicine are shared. This collaboration has led to important discoveries in the understanding of ED, such as the role of cardiovascular health, hormone levels, and psychological factors in the condition. The ISSM encourages ongoing research through grants and sponsorship of studies that aim to improve both the prevention and treatment of ED.
    • Educational Initiatives: Like the AUA and SMSNA, the ISSM is also heavily invested in education. It offers professional development opportunities for healthcare providers, including courses and webinars on the latest treatments and research. For the public, the ISSM provides resources that aim to reduce the stigma surrounding ED and encourage men to seek help when needed. Their focus on holistic, patient-centered care ensures that both the physical and emotional aspects of erectile dysfunction are addressed.
